Before removing both of the rear flexible hoses, place an identification mark on each rear flexible hose to indicate whether it is for the left side or right side of the vehicle.
When reusing the rear flexible hose, place matchmarks on the rear flexible hose and rear flexible hose bracket before removal so that it can be reinstalled in its original position.
1.REMOVE REAR WHEEL
2.DRAIN BRAKE FLUID
If brake fluid leaks onto any painted surface, immediately wash it off.

3.REMOVE REAR FLEXIBLE HOSE LH
Using a union nut wrench, disconnect the 2 brake lines while holding the rear flexible hose LH with a wrench.
Do not kink or damage the brake line.
Do not allow any foreign matter such as dirt or dust to enter the brake line from the connecting parts.
Remove the 2 clips and rear flexible hose LH.

4.REMOVE REAR FLEXIBLE HOSE RH
Using a union nut wrench, disconnect the 2 brake lines while holding the rear flexible hose RH with a wrench.
Do not kink or damage the brake line.
Do not allow any foreign matter such as dirt or dust to enter the brake line from the connecting parts.
Remove the 2 clips and rear flexible hose RH.
